This is the documentation page for the FTDI-serial board.

overview

The FTDI-serial board has an USB connector and a 3-pin serial/UART connector. The brains of the PCB is an FT232RL chip.

pinout

The 3 pin connector is connected as follows

1Ground (G)
2Rx (R)
3Tx (T)
  • led1 is connected to CBUS0 (Tx activity)
  • led2 is connected to BCUS1 (Rx activity)
  • led3 is connected to VCC

Jumper settings

IO voltage
1-2: 3V3 (jumper near C2)
2-3: 5V (jumper near the edge of the board
